SPEC Pak IP67 Connector
SPECK Pak Connector
Anderson Power Products introduces its new SPEC Pak Connector. The SPEC Pak (Sealed Power for Environmental Connections) has an environmentally sealed IP67 shell to protect existing APP contacts and housings.
The company’s customer-configured SPEC Pak Connectors may be used anywhere a rugged or waterproof high-power signal and ground interconnection solution is required such as in: mass transportation, off-road vehicles, factory automation, oil and petro-chemical exploration, agricultural equipment and more.
The core technology is Powerpoles. Powerpoles give users extensive options, which may be specified. When Powerpoles are combined within the SPEC Pak, the result is a powerful environmental interconnect for use in a number of demanding applications.
The core APP Powerpole technology is proven reliable and cost-effective. The broad selection of touch safe, color-coded Powerpole houses up to 45 amps, with power, signal and ground contacts and accepts a broad range of wire gauges including #24 to #10 AWG, giving users thousands of flexible design solutions in a single interconnect.

MAC Trailer Offers JOST A440 Magnum Landing Gear
Jost Landing Gear
MAC Trailer Manufacturing of Alliance, Ohio, partners with JOST to have the A440 MAGNUM Landing Gear standard on all MAC trailers. With a gear box filled with an arctic-grade all-weather white grease, the benefit of not having to lubricate the landing gear for five years equates to direct savings in reduced maintenance costs for the owner.
The sealed design of the system keeps water out and keeps water away from the rotating shafts to eliminate internal corrosion problems on the landing gear. The elevating screws are completely encased by a grease tube that lubricates each time the legs are extended or retracted. The two-speed landing gear has a rated lift capacity of 62,500 pounds. PACCAR Introduces the ACRAFIT Anti-Siphon Device
ACRAFIT Anti-Siphon Device
PACCAR Parts introduces the ACRAFIT anti-siphon device that can help heavy-duty truck operators and truck fleets from having their profits siphoned off by fuel thieves.
The ACRAFIT anti-siphon device’s unique, patented design ensures maximum security, easy installation and rapid fueling. The after-market device is installed in the neck of the fuel tank. Its one-piece construction, with openings no larger than a quarter inch, keeps thieves from reaching the diesel fuel with large-diameter siphon tubes.
The ACRAFIT anti-siphon line includes various sizes to fit all major OEM fuel tank applications and comes with a 10-year unlimited mileage warranty.
Some owner-operators and drivers report that in the time it took them to have a break at a rest area or truck stop, thieves managed to pump up to 100 gallons of fuel from their trucks’ fuel tanks. Valley Introduces Electric Tongue Jack for Trailers
Electric Tongue Jack
Hooking trailers to tow vehicles just got easier with the new Electric Tongue Jack for deluxe models #76057 in white and #76058 in black from Valley.
Designed to reduce the physical exertion associated with manual jacks, the new electric tongue is available in two models. The base model, which fits couplers with a 2-inch opening, comes with a non-telescoping foot that works with a motor to lift the trailer.
The deluxe model is for use on trailers with a 2-1/2-inch coupler opening and includes a manual telescoping foot, which saves on battery life and consumption, extends the life of the motor and eliminates the need to carry a block of wood or other object around to lift the trailer. Simply pull a pin, let the foot collapse down, re-insert the pin and lift the trailer off the ball using the electric motor.
Each of Valley’s Electric Tongue Jacks features a black or white powder coat finish, an aluminum motor housing cover and an LED work light – a benefit over incandescent lighting as it doesn’t drain the battery dead or melt the light lens if accidentally left on. They each come with a handle for optional manual operation.
The jack has an aluminum gear housing and powder-coated, zinc-plated shaft assembly construction and is rated for a total load capacity of 3,500 pounds.

New MAC Bottom Rail Protects Wiring
MAC Bottom Rail
A new MAC extruded aluminum bottom rail has been engineered for all the MVP (MAC Vertical Panel) MACLOCK smooth side dump and transfer trailers. The new rail is of a hollow design providing a weather resistant channel for the installation and wiring of the side lights. This helps prevent maintenance costs stemming from wiring that has gone bad from winter road salt, mud, road-landfill debris and problems associated exposure to the elements. Meritor WABCO Introduces Pan 22 Trailer Air Disc Brake
Meritor WABCO extends its PAN air disc brake family with the introduction of the PAN 22, the first advanced single-piston air disc brake designed for North American Commercial trailers with 22.5-inch wheels and axles rated to 22,000 pounds.
Currently available as a trailer OEM option, the new brake was demonstrated recently. The single piston air disc brake family will be in tractors, trucks and buses, given its compact design and low weight.
The PAN 22 combines best-in-class braking torque output with the low weight and long pad life. The overall low cost of ownership has contributed to the PAN family of brakes registering as one of the most cost-effective air disc brake ranges available.
At 79 pounds including pads, the PAN 22 weighs less than any other air disc brake in its class. It also delivers powerful braking torque performance – up to 24,000 Nm. It has larger, thicker pads than competitive designs, which results in longer pad replacement intervals. |
